Output ddeb46e2826dcf016a03653c82b5eb8105043bb4b6118a8b8c871a3280749ebe:0

value
6976355136017
script pubkey
OP_0 OP_PUSHBYTES_20 3a1d833f37bb011d208e72b8c93408c07a9d1136
address
tb1q8gwcx0ehhvq36gyww2uvjdqgcpaf6yfk0tk0e7
transaction
ddeb46e2826dcf016a03653c82b5eb8105043bb4b6118a8b8c871a3280749ebe
confirmations
166742
spent
true